Likit Preeyanon is a medical technologist turned software developer and academic leader, currently Deputy Dean for Information Technology at Mahidol University. He combines microbiology, data management, and bioinformatics with hands-on software engineering to build data pipelines and web applications for data warehousing and sharing. A self-taught coder, he specializes in Python, Docker, and full-stack development with Vue.js and Flask, supported by PostgreSQL and MySQL. Since 2014 he has balanced teaching and research with leadership, serving as Assistant Professor and previously Head of Department, and he is the Secretary General of the Medical Technology Council Thailand. Based in Phutthamonthon, Thailand, he brings 14 years of experience spanning academia, governance, and data-driven infrastructure. He earned a PhD in Microbiology and Molecular Genetics from Michigan State University, grounding his work in rigorous experimental science.
